ISLAMABAD: Award-winning Pakistani fashion model Ayyan Ali was indicted yesterday on charges she tried to smuggle $500,000 in undeclared cash from Islamabad to Dubai, court officials said. Ali, 22, was arrested in March for allegedly trying to fly out of the Pakistani capital to Dubai with the cash on her person. She was released on bail in July, and on Thursday she appeared in a Pakistani customs court, where a judge "indicted her over currency smuggling charges," a court official told AFP.

The high-profile model pleaded not guilty, the official added. If convicted she faces fines, the confiscation of property, and up to ten years in jail.

The judge fixed the next hearing on December 8 and ordered the customs officials to produce witnesses, the official said. Ali's lawyer Latif Khosa could not be reached for comment with his office saying he was too busy to speak to media. - AFP
